What's the richest high school?

I'm doing a research project on education and wealth disparity. Does anyone know which high school is considered the richest in terms of funding and resources?

a year ago

The concept of the "richest" high school can be tricky to nail down as it largely depends on how you measure wealth. From a purely financial perspective, yes, some schools have more funding due to the wealth of their surrounding area or because they're privately funded. That being said, one frequently cited example is Phillips Academy Andover, a private, coeducational high school located in Massachusetts.

Phillips Andover's endowment is significant (around $1 billion as of a few years ago), which allows the school to dedicate enormous resources to student scholarships, campus improvements, faculty salaries, and academic resources. However, it's worth remembering that while financial resources can offer opportunities, they are not the sole determinants of a supportive and enriching educational experience.

For instance, some public schools in affluent areas may not have sizable endowments but still have substantial resources because of their location. For example, the Scarsdale Public School system in New York and other similar districts are known for their high property taxes, which directly impact the funding and resources available to the schools.

Yet, wealth and quality of education always do not go hand in hand, and there is a broader conversation about wealth disparities in education. This mostly reveals that many public schools are underfunded and could use more resources to support their students.
